![]() At medium range or beyond, a level 3 Sentry Gun under constant repair can tank a Heavy's fire for the full duration of an ÜberCharge. ![]() Tactics: Repair your Sentry Gun as it does your dirty work, crouching between your buildings to minimize the damage you take. Your Sentry Gun may need support to hold an area against an aggressive Heavy. Relative merits: Your Sentry Gun has plenty of firepower and bulk, but you yourself do not. In particular, you can clear Stickybomb traps so your team can safely advance. The Short Circuit can destroy his explosives for as long as you have metal.The Rescue Ranger can help you save a building under bombardment from a distance.The Shotgun is one of your best direct combat weapons for pursuing the Demoman.If he does not have the Ali Baba’s Wee Booties, it means he has a Grenade Launcher equipped and can still pose a hazard. You have considerably less to worry about if the Demoman trades in the Stickybomb Launcher for a shield and melee weapon. If necessary, shoot the Stickybombs with bullets to destroy them or haul your Sentry Gun away. Rather than sit behind and continuously repair your buildings, take the fight to an aggressive Demoman with your Shotgun or lay down suppressive fire with the Wrangler. Tactics: Avoid placing your Sentry Gun out in the open or right around corners, where a Demoman can easily place a carpet of Stickybombs. He can fire projectiles from behind cover or simply prepare a pile of Stickybombs to destroy your buildings in a single explosion, preventing any repairs. Relative merits: The Demoman is one of your greatest threats. The Pistol can whittle down the Pyro’s health at a safe distance.The Combat Mini-Sentry Gun is particularly less effective against the Pyro, as it can be easily circle strafed or destroyed during deployment. If your Sentry Gun is at level 3, be prepared for the occasional compression blast that reflects your Sentry Gun's rockets back to you. Tactics: Mindful building placement prevents the Pyro from using the Flame Thrower to attack from around a corner, while taking cover behind your buildings neutralizes any long range potential the Flare Gun holds. The Pyro's Flame Thrower can damage you through your buildings, making enclosed areas more pressuring to hold. Relative merits: Proper Sentry Gun placement can protect a wide area, completely forcing the Pyro away. The Short Circuit's energy ball can destroy rockets to protect your buildings.Its shielding also buys time for a proper response from your team. The Wrangler can extend your Sentry Gun's range to target a faraway Soldier.The Rescue Ranger can be used to repair or haul your Sentry Gun without taking splash damage from rockets.The stock Shotgun and Panic Attack are the most reliable options for taking out a Soldier away from your Sentry Gun.The Direct Hit has harder hitting rockets that can very easily destroy your buildings, while the Cow Mangler, although weaker, can disable your Sentry Gun with a charged shot. If you can't do any of those, haul your buildings to a better position.Ĭheck the Rocket Launcher he has equipped. You can utilize cover, ask teammates for help, or engage the Soldier himself while your Sentry Gun distracts him. Tactics: Position your Sentry Gun so that the enemy Soldier cannot freely fire upon it. He also has the firepower to deal with you if you try chasing him down. Relative merits: The Soldier can freely barrage your buildings from outside your Sentry Gun's range while taking cover between shots. Equipping the Gunslinger gives additional health and Combat Mini-Sentry Guns, which let you dominate the match-up if you are roaming.If the Scout uses Bonk! Atomic Punch to distract your Sentry Gun for his teammates, you can use the Wrangler to manually target other enemies.In this case, strafe side-to-side, fire away whenever he enters your crosshairs, and consider using the Gunslinger and Combat Mini-Sentry Guns. If you are on the offensive or constantly on the move, you may be forced to directly fight the Scout without your Sentry Gun. If you can rely on teammates to hold a main area, your Sentry Gun can be instead placed to cover flanking routes to specifically deter ambushers. ![]() Tactics: To keep the Scout away, stay near your buildings and repair any chip damage he might inflict. The Scout's weapons are not powerful enough to handle a Sentry Gun directly the best he can do is phase through with Bonk! Atomic Punch.Īway from your Sentry Gun, the two of you have similar weapons, but the Scout’s harder-hitting Scattergun and faster movement speed gives him the upper hand. The Sentry Gun never misses, making the Scout's mobility completely useless, and quickly chews through the Scout's low 125 health. Relative merits: Your Sentry Gun makes you the best class for defending an area against the Scout.
